Beyond the basic license, certifications tell a story of expertise. For example, a professional accredited in asphalt shingles or metal roofing has actually gone through rigorous training customized to those materials. Believe of accreditations as the difference between a generalist and a specialist-- they signify knowledge that can save you headaches down the roadway.

Ever wonder why your roofing suddenly seems like a sieve after a storm? Roofer don't simply slap on shingles; they carry out a symphony of services tailored to secure your sanctuary. From meticulous evaluations to emergency situation repairs, these specialists wield tools and strategies honed over years of battling the aspects.
hammer swings, a thorough roof assessment reveals subtle indications of wear-- curling shingles, tiny fractures, or granule loss-- that only an experienced eye can spot. Think of it as a health check for your home's crown. This step is vital due to the fact that overlooking small concerns can lead to water seepage, jeopardizing structural stability.
Leakages can sneak in through the tiniest spaces. Competent specialists patch these breaches, replacing harmed shingles or sealing flashing with accuracy. It's not almost repairing what's visible; they resolve concealed vulnerabilities lurking underneath. A story I heard from a specialist: a homeowner overlooked a minor drip, just to find rotten wood a year later on. Prompt repair work conserve dollars and headaches.
Selecting the right roof matters. Whether it's asphalt shingles, metal panels, or tile, specialists ensure proper installation to maximize life expectancy and energy performance. Replacement isn't merely tearing off old roofing; it involves examining decking condition, ventilation, and insulation. Ever become aware of ice damming? Poor ventilation can trigger it, resulting in premature roofing failure.

Roof professionals need to browse a maze of guidelines developed to protect employees from falls, electrical risks, and even direct exposure to harsh weather condition
Consider this: the Occupational Security and Health Administration (OSHA) mandates strict fall protection measures for anyone working above six feet. Sounds simple, but in practice, it suggests rigorous training, appropriate use of harnesses, guardrails, and sometimes, a total rethink of how a job is approached.
One veteran roofer when shared how a simple checklist conserved his group from a close call-- spotting a weak shingle that might've led to a fall. That's the edge that comes from experience: preparing for threats unnoticeable to the untrained eye.
Guideline | Function | Practical Suggestion |
---|---|---|
OSHA Fall Security | Prevent falls from heights over 6 feet | Frequently train crew and carry out pre-job security instructions |
Personal Protective Devices (PPE) | Guard employees from threats like particles and chemicals | Purchase comfy, resilient PPE to encourage constant usage |
Danger Interaction Requirement | Ensure awareness of chemical dangers | Label and shop products properly, review Safety Data Sheets |
